Be Kind to Your Spine: Back pain is one of the most common ailments plaguing adults today. Take back your quality of life by strengthening core muscles around the spine, shoulders and abdomen. The first level in the Back Care Series, Be Kind to Your Spine, is a great way to improve flexibility, mobility and functional fitness. It is ideal for fitness instructors and rehabilitation practitioners.
Pain-Free Posture: The back is the foundation for functional fitness. Everyone can benefit from strengthening the deep support muscles around the spine. This second level Back Care Pilates Series workout continues to build on core stability, spinal alignment and range of mobility, so you can develop pain-free posture. Master Instructor Trainer, Moira Merrithew, coaches you through an exercise program that engages both mind and body as you work towards a strong, healthy, stress-free back.
Standing Tall: The Standing Tall workout is ideal for improving posture allowing your client to stand both tall and straight. If lower back pain, neck tension and postural problems are cramping your quality of life, this program can help you. With concentrated effort, you’ll learn to lengthen your spine, correct your posture and stand up strong and tall. Let Master Instructor Trainer Moira Merrithew lead you through a stretching, strengthening and streamlining workout that activates the mind and the body towards optimal back care.
DVD Contents
Be Kind to Your Spine: 19 exercises; Workout Time - 27 min
Chapters
EXERCISES: Breathing Forward, Breathing Sitting, Flex Elbows - Open Chest, Imprint & Release, Leg Slides, Hip Release, Spinal Rotation, Spine Twist, Cat Stretch, Hip Rolls, Scapula Isolation, Shoulder Rolls, Arm Raises, Arm Circles, Head Nods, Ab Prep, Breast Stroke Prep 1, Shell Stretch, Mermaid
Pain-Free Posture: 23 exercises; Workout Time - 29 min
Chapters
EXERCISES: Breathing, Transversus Connection, Imprint & Release, Hip Release, Spinal Rotation, Cat Stretch, Hip Rolls, Scapula Isolation, Rib Cage Placement, Arm Circles, Head Nods, Ab Prep, Breast Stroke Prep, Shell Stretch, Half Roll Back, Spine Twist, Single Leg Stretch Prep, Shoulder Bridge Prep, Side Kicks, Single Leg Extension, Leg Pull Front Prep, Mermaid
Standing Tall: 26 exercises; Main Program - 38 min
Chapters
EXERCISES: Breathing, Transversus Connection, Imprint & Release, Toe Taps, Hip Release, Spinal Rotation, Cat Stretch, Rib Cage Placement, Arm Circles, Head Nods, Ab Prep, Breast Stroke, Shell Stretch, Hundred Modification, Half Roll Back, Spine Twist, Single Leg Stretch Modification, Obliques Modification, Shoulder Bridge Prep, Side Kick, Single Leg Extension, Swan Dive Prep, Swimming Prep, Leg Pull Front Prep, Push Up Prep, Mermaid
